沧州市金长红游戏软件网
登录
网站目录
图片名称

全面解析数据库中numeric类型的特性与应用实例

手机访问

在现代数据库管理系统中,数据类型的选择对于数据存储和处理的效率有着至关重要的影响。其中,numeric类型因其精确性和广泛适用性,成为了处理数值数据的主流选择之...

发布时间:2024-11-28 23:37:26
软件评分:还没有人打分
  • 软件介绍
  • 其他版本

在现代数据库管理系统中,数据类型的选择对于数据存储和处理的效率有着至关重要的影响。其中,numeric类型因其精确性和广泛适用性,成为了处理数值数据的主流选择之一。numeric类型通常用于存储具有固定小数位数或精确需求的数值,这在财务计算、统计分析和科学计算中尤为重要。通过深入分析numeric类型的特性,我们可以更好地理解其在实际应用中的优势与局限。

全面解析数据库中numeric类型的特性与应用实例

首先,numeric类型的最显著特征是其高精度和可控的小数位数。与浮点数相比,numeric类型避免了因四舍五入产生的误差,确保了计算结果的精确性。这一点在金融行业尤其重要,例如,在处理货币交易时,使用numeric类型可以明确指定金额的小数位数,从而避免因精度问题造成的财务损失。此外,numeric类型可以支持大规模的数值,适合存储高达几百位数的数字,满足不同行业的需求。

其次,在性能方面,numeric类型的操作可能相对较慢,尤其是在进行大量运算时。这是因为numeric类型在存储和计算过程中需要更多的内存和计算资源。尽管如此,大多数数据库系统对numeric类型都进行了优化,以提高性能。例如,商用数据库如Oracle和PostgreSQL都提供了针对numeric类型的高效处理机制,能够在提供高精度的同时,尽量减少性能损失。因此,在选择数据类型时,应根据具体的应用场景和性能需求进行权衡。

在实际应用中,numeric类型的使用场景广泛。例如,在电子商务平台中,商品价格和订单金额通常都以numeric类型存储,确保准确的财务记录。在统计分析中,研究人员在进行实验数据收集时,也倾向于使用numeric类型,以确保实验结果的可靠性。此外,在保险、税务以及任何需要计算和存储精确数值的行业中,numeric类型的应用也愈发普遍。

然而,numeric类型并不是没有局限性。由于其相对较高的存储要求,使用numeric类型可能会导致数据库占用更多的存储空间。此外,针对非常大的数据集,numeric类型在某些情况下可能会造成性能瓶颈。因此,在设计数据库时,合理选择数据类型、平衡精度与性能,以及考虑数据量的预期增长至关重要。

综上所述,numeric类型作为数据库中一种重要的数值数据类型,以其高精度和灵活性广泛应用于各个行业。理解numeric类型的特性及其适用场景,可以帮助开发者在设计数据库时做出更明智的决策。尽管其在性能和存储方面仍存在一定考虑,但其以精确度为核心的优势,使得numeric类型在需要严谨数据处理的场合,始终占据着不可或缺的位置。

  • 不喜欢(2
特别声明

本网站“沧州市金长红游戏软件网”提供的软件《全面解析数据库中numeric类型的特性与应用实例》,版权归第三方开发者或发行商所有。本网站“沧州市金长红游戏软件网”在2024-11-28 23:37:26收录《全面解析数据库中numeric类型的特性与应用实例》时,该软件的内容都属于合规合法。后期软件的内容如出现违规,请联系网站管理员进行删除。软件《全面解析数据库中numeric类型的特性与应用实例》的使用风险由用户自行承担,本网站“沧州市金长红游戏软件网”不对软件《全面解析数据库中numeric类型的特性与应用实例》的安全性和合法性承担任何责任。

图片名称
图片名称